Coal power stations going broke: Schott – The Australian Financial Review
At the current rate of renewable energy growth, coal power stations could shut four or five years earlier than their rated lifespan, Energy Security Board chairwoman…

AGL, however, holds an advantage compared with its rivals because its Bayswater and Loy Yang A plants are the lowest-cost coal plants in NSW and Victoria, respectively, he added.
AGL is already due to close its Liddell coal power generator in the NSW Hunter Valley by April 2023, but a five-year acceleration of other major coal plant closures would see Deltas Vales Point plant close the following year, while EnergyAustralias Yallourn and Origin Energys huge Eraring plant would shut as early as 2027,…
